#ece2b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ece2b4 is composed of 92.5% red, 88.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.2%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 49.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 81.6%. #ece2b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d9c569.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#ece2b4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ece2b4 has RGB values of R:236, G:226,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.24,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15524532.

Shades and Tints of #ece2b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ece2b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d3d2cd is the less saturated color, while #feeea2 is the most saturated one.
